Java 8 Windows 下载:从入门到精通
简介
在当今的软件开发领域,Java 8 依然是广泛使用且功能强大的版本。对于 Windows 用户而言,正确下载和配置 Java 8 是开启 Java 开发之旅的重要一步。本博客将详细介绍 Java 8 在 Windows 系统上的下载、使用以及相关的最佳实践,帮助开发者快速上手并高效运用 Java 8 进行项目开发。
目录
- Java 8 Windows Download 基础概念
- Java 8 在 Windows 上的下载步骤
- 使用方法
- 常见实践
- 最佳实践
- 小结
- 参考资料
Java 8 Windows Download 基础概念
Java 8 是 Oracle 公司发布的 Java 编程语言的一个重要版本,它引入了许多新特性,如 Lambda 表达式、Stream API、新的日期和时间 API 等,大大提升了开发效率和代码的可读性。
在 Windows 系统上下载 Java 8,意味着获取适用于 Windows 操作系统的 Java 运行时环境(JRE)或 Java 开发工具包(JDK)。JRE 是运行 Java 程序所必需的环境,而 JDK 除了包含 JRE 外,还提供了开发 Java 程序所需的工具,如编译器、调试器等。
Java 8 在 Windows 上的下载步骤
- 访问 Oracle 官方网站:打开浏览器,访问 Oracle Java 下载页面:https://www.oracle.com/java/technologies/javase/javase8u211-later-archive-downloads.html。
- 选择合适的版本:在下载页面中,找到适合 Windows 系统的版本。有 32 位和 64 位之分,根据你的 Windows 系统版本选择相应的下载链接。例如,如果你的 Windows 是 64 位系统,选择 Windows x64 版本。
- 接受许可协议:在下载之前,需要接受 Oracle 的许可协议。勾选同意选项。
- 开始下载:点击对应的下载链接,开始下载安装文件。下载完成后,找到下载的文件(通常是一个.exe 文件)。
- 安装 Java 8:双击下载的.exe 文件,按照安装向导的提示进行操作。在安装过程中,可以选择安装路径等选项,一般保持默认设置即可。
使用方法
设置环境变量
安装完成后,需要设置 Java 环境变量,以便系统能够找到 Java 命令。 1. 打开系统属性:右键点击“此电脑”,选择“属性”,然后在弹出的窗口中点击“高级系统设置”。 2. 设置 Path 变量:在“系统属性”窗口中,点击“环境变量”按钮。在“系统变量”中找到“Path”变量,点击“编辑”。 3. 添加 Java 路径:在“编辑环境变量”窗口中,点击“新建”,然后输入 Java 的 bin 目录路径。例如,如果 Java 安装在“C:\Program Files\Java\jdk1.8.0_211”,则添加“C:\Program Files\Java\jdk1.8.0_211\bin”。点击“确定”保存设置。
验证安装
打开命令提示符(CMD),输入命令 java -version
。如果安装成功,将显示 Java 8 的版本信息,例如:
java version "1.8.0_211"
Java(TM) SE Runtime Environment (build 1.8.0_211-b12)
Java HotSpot(TM) 64-Bit Server VM (build 25.211-b12, mixed mode)
简单的 Java 代码示例
创建一个简单的 Java 类,保存为 HelloWorld.java
:
public class HelloWorld {
public static void main(String[] args) {
System.out.println("Hello, World!");
}
}
在命令提示符中,进入保存 HelloWorld.java
的目录,然后使用命令 javac HelloWorld.java
编译代码,生成 HelloWorld.class
文件。接着使用命令 java HelloWorld
运行程序,将输出“Hello, World!”。
常见实践
开发 Java 应用程序
使用 IDE(如 IntelliJ IDEA、Eclipse 等)进行 Java 应用程序开发。在 IDE 中配置好 Java 8 的 JDK 路径,即可开始创建项目、编写代码、调试程序等。
运行 Java Web 应用
结合 Tomcat 等 Web 服务器,开发和部署 Java Web 应用。确保 Tomcat 的环境变量配置正确,并且使用的是与 Java 8 兼容的版本。
构建项目
使用构建工具如 Maven 或 Gradle。在项目的 pom.xml
(Maven)或 build.gradle
(Gradle)文件中指定使用 Java 8 版本,例如 Maven 的配置:
<properties>
<maven.compiler.source>1.8</maven.compiler.source>
<maven.compiler.target>1.8</maven.compiler.target>
</properties>
最佳实践
保持更新
定期关注 Oracle 官方网站,获取 Java 8 的最新更新。更新通常包含性能优化、安全补丁等,有助于提升应用程序的稳定性和安全性。
内存管理
在编写 Java 代码时,合理使用内存。利用 Java 8 的新特性,如 Stream API 进行高效的数据处理,避免内存泄漏等问题。
代码规范
遵循良好的 Java 代码规范,充分利用 Java 8 的特性提升代码质量。例如,使用 Lambda 表达式简化匿名内部类的写法,使代码更加简洁和易读。
小结
通过本文,我们详细了解了 Java 8 在 Windows 系统上的下载过程、使用方法、常见实践以及最佳实践。从基础概念到实际操作,希望读者能够顺利下载并使用 Java 8 进行开发工作。合理运用 Java 8 的新特性和最佳实践,将有助于提高开发效率和代码质量,为项目的成功实施提供有力保障。
参考资料
- Oracle Java 官方网站:https://www.oracle.com/java/
- Java 8 教程:https://docs.oracle.com/javase/tutorial/java/index.html